Problem

Existing fishing rod holders installed in boats are non-adjustable, leading to issues such as entanglement, damage to rods and crafts, and corrosion of fasteners, as well as compromised rod positions during fishing.

Innovation Solution

A rotatable flush-mounted fishing rod holder with a rod holding tube and annular flange that allows for adjustable positioning, featuring a radially extending flange and cover member for secure attachment to the gunwale while enabling rotation, and optional features like friction members and tensioning elements for ease of use.

2Object-affected harmful factors

If rods are held in a fixed canted position, then the holder structure is simple, but rods protrude laterally causing damage to rods and craft

Engineering Contradiction:
Improverod and craft damageVSAvoidrod access for re-rigging
Core Design Contradiction:
Object-affected harmful factorsVSEase of operation

Solution Approach 1:

The rotatable tube allows rods to be positioned dynamically - can be angled rearwardly during travel to prevent lateral protrusion and damage, and rotated to accessible positions when re-rigging or fish removal is needed, eliminating the need for complete rod removal.

3Object-affected harmful factors

If fasteners are exposed on top of the gunnel, then installation is simple, but fasteners are exposed to elements causing corrosion

Engineering Contradiction:
Improvefastener corrosionVSAvoidinstallation complexity
Core Design Contradiction:
Object-affected harmful factorsVSEase of manufacture

Solution Approach 1:

The rod holder tube is nested within the gunwale opening, with the mounting fasteners positioned inside the gunwale structure rather than exposed on top. The tube extends through the gunwale with its upper end positioned within the opening, concealing the fasteners from direct exposure to weather elements while maintaining secure installation.

AI summary

A rotatable flush mounted fishing rod holder including a rod holding tube with an annular flange extending radially from an upper end thereof, and an annular cover member to attach relative to a surface over the annular flange to hold the rod holding tube to the surface but allow rotation of the rod holding tube relative thereto.
